Examine the extract of the /etc/nologin file and the /etc/pam.d/login file on server1:[[email protected] ~] # cat /etc/nologin bob smith[[email protected] ~] # cat /etc/pam.d/login accountrequiredpam_nologin.so accountincludesystem-authWhich statement is true about users?auth required pam_nologin.so — This is the final authentication step. It checks whether the /etc/nologin file exists. If it exists and the user is not root, authentication fails.*The /etc/nologin file contains the message displayed to users attempting to log on to a machine in the process of being shutdown.*the login program defines its service name as login and installs the /etc/pam.d/login PAM configuration file.
